花店管理系统项目报告

花店管理系统项目报告

ID:9086941

大小:1.33 MB

页数:6页

时间:2018-04-17

花店管理系统项目报告_第1页
花店管理系统项目报告_第2页
花店管理系统项目报告_第3页
花店管理系统项目报告_第4页
花店管理系统项目报告_第5页
资源描述:

《花店管理系统项目报告》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、XX工业职业技术学院Java项目开发实训项目报告完成人:XXX所在班级:软件1班指导教师:XXX完成时间:2013年6月14日所在系部:信息管理技术学院-5-一.设计项目名称:鲜花管理系统二.小组成员及分工组员1:登录,添加,数据库设计组员2:全部查询,修改,页面美化组员3:搜索查询,删除,查找资料三.项目功能需求分析介绍系统计划设计的主要功能,简要描述功能的实现方案。可以绘制功能框图。鲜花管理系统主界面添加鲜花信息所有种类信息鲜花信息的修改鲜花信息的删除鲜花种类包含的信息所有鲜花的信息登录登录失败图1总

2、体流程图四.项目数据库设计数据库的表有哪些,每张表的字段怎样设计,数据库表之间有什么关系。FlowerInfo表表1FlowerInfo表字段名数据类型是否为空约束备注idint否主键序号fwNovarchar(50)否鲜花编号fwNamevarchar(50)否鲜花名称fwPricedecimal是鲜花价格fwNumberint是鲜花数量fwPicturevarchar(50)是图片storeIDint是店铺编号表2StoreInfo表字段名数据类型是否为空约束备注idInt否主键序号storeNova

3、rchar(50)否店铺编号storeNamevarchar(50)否店铺名称commodityGradefloat是鲜花新鲜评价-5-serviceGradefloat是服务态度评价deliverGradevarchar(50)是发货速度评价表3User表字段名数据类型是否为空约束备注idInt否主键用户编号userNamevarchar(50)是用户名passwordvarchar(50)是用户密码五.完成的主要功能1.客户进入到主页面客户可以根据自己的需求进入到鲜花商城的主页面,查找自己需要的鲜花进

4、行购买,并且在该页面可以查询鲜花的任何信息。如下图:图2用户的主页面2.鲜花种类查询页面上有鲜花种类查询,可以查询到鲜花的种类,让客户了解到我们商城有哪些种类,让客户有更多的选择,根据送花的对象选择鲜花的种类。。在这个页面中主要运用了分页的方法和Hibernate查询,PageBean类,PageBeanfindAllByPage(intpageSize,intpage)方法。如图:图3鲜花种类查询(分页)3.搜索查询在页面的左上角有搜索查询,可以方便客户进行筛选查询,方便了客户,免去了一些麻烦,这样会使

5、客户需要再次光临,并且还可以查询到该种类的评价。该页面也是使用Hibernate进行的查询,是根据某个字段进行的查询。如图:-5-图4鲜花种类的具体查询4.管理员登录管理员根据自己的账号登录到管理系统页面,在登录的过程中,管理员的账号和密码不能匹配就会登录失败,反之,管理员成功登录。在登录的过程中。系统根据管理员输入的账号和密码去查询数据库。如图:图5管理员登录图6管理系统的主页面5.添加鲜花信息管理员登录,进入index.jsp主界面,进入鲜花管理系统的后台管理页面,选择“添加鲜花信息”进入添加鲜花信息

6、页面,输入要添加鲜花的名称、编号等,点击添加若添加成功则跳转到Success.jsp页面,若失败则返回添加页面在该功能实现时,需要FlowerInfoDAOImpl类,和函数booleanaddFwInfo(FlowerInfofwInfo)、booleanisExistfwBasicInfo(StringfwNo)、doAddFlower()的方法。如下图:-5-图7添加鲜花基本信息6.查询鲜花信息管理员可以查看自己系统下有多少鲜花信息,进入到鲜花信息查询页面,该页面显示所有的鲜花详细信息。该功能实现时

7、,需要FlowerInfoDAOImpl类,ListsearcherAllFwInfo()、toSearchFlower()方法。如下图:图8鲜花详细信息7.修改鲜花信息管理员进入到鲜花详细信息页面之后,可以根据自己掌握的详细信息进行对某个鲜花信息进行修改,在进入到修改页面,该鲜花所有的信息将全部绑定到页面中,管理员可以进行修改保存。功能在实现时,需要FlowerInfoDAOImpl类,booleanupdateFwInformation(intid)、doUpdateFwInfor()方法,在修改页面

8、也需要根据鲜花的序号进行查询绑定。如下图:图9鲜花信息的修改8.删除鲜花信息-5-管理员进入到鲜花详细信息页面之后,可以根据鲜花的库存量进行删除,或是其他原因,在点击删除时会提示你是否要进行删除该信息,点击确定就能删除,再次回到全部鲜花信息页面,就会看到该鲜花信息已删除。在这功能里运用的booleandeleteFwInformation(intid)、doDeleteFwInfor()方法。如下图:图10鲜花信息的删除-5-

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。